Context: The increasing popularity of JavaScript (JS) has lead to a variety of frameworks that aim to help developers to address programming tasks. However, the number of JS Frameworks (JSF) has risen rapidly to thousands and more. It is difficult for practitioners to identify the frameworks that best fit to their needs and to develop new frameworks that fit such needs. Existing research has focused in proposing software metrics for the frameworks, which do not carry a high value to practitioners. While benchmarks, technical reports, and experts' opinions are available, they suffer the same issue that they do not carry much value. In particular, there is a lack of knowledge regarding the processes and reasons that drive developers towards the choice. Objective: This paper explores the human aspects of software development behind the decision-making process that leads to a choice of a JSF. Method: We conducted a qualitative interpretive study, following the grounded theory data analysis methodology. We interviewed 18 participants who are decision makers in their companies or entrepreneurs, or are able to motivate the JSF decision-making process. Results: We offer a model of factors that are desirable to be found in a JSF and a representation of the decision makers involved in the frameworks selection. The factors are usability (attractiveness, learnability, understandability), cost, efficiency (performance, size), and functionality (automatisation, extensibility, flexibility, isolation, modularity, suitability, updated). These factors are evaluated by a combination of four possible decision makers, which are customer, developer, team, and team leader. Conclusion: Our model contributes to the body of knowledge related to the decision-making process when selecting a JSF. As a practical implication, we believe that our model is useful for (1) Web developers and (2) JSF developers.

主要发现
- 选择JavaScript框架的决策过程由四个核心因素共同驱动:可用性、成本、效率与功能特性。
- 可用性涵盖外观吸引力、易学性与可理解性,最受开发者与团队负责人重视。
- 成本考量包括许可、维护与长期可持续性,主要由客户与团队负责人评估。
- 效率因素如性能与框架大小,对关注运行时优化的开发者与团队至关重要。
- 功能特性如模块化、可扩展性与适用性,不同角色的评估方式各异,团队负责人尤为关注长期可维护性。
- 该模型表明,单一决策者不会统一评估所有因素,且基于利益相关方角色会产生不同的权衡取舍。
